Suppose the linear transformation T: P2-->P3 is defined as follows: T(p(t))=(a0+a1t+a2t2)=(a2-2a1)t+(a1-a0)t3. Describe all of the vectors p(t) in the kernal of T.

Solution

T(p(t))=0 gives:

(a2-2a1)t+(a1-a0)t^3=0

a2-2a1=0

a1-a0=0

Hence, a2=2a1,a0=a1

So,

p(t)=a1(1+t+2t^2) are the vectors in kernel of T
